    hey guys, ok i have just started a new blog (see siggy) and was able to cloak my affiliate links using PHP

    basically what i did was

    ?php

    $redirecturl = 'http://my....affiliate...link...inserted...here';
    header('location: '.$redirecturl);

    ?>


    and save as .PHP file, the theme im using (woo themes) let me easily do this for my banners but i want to know how its possible to insert this code into posts. i know this is possible but im not sure how

    when writing a post how would i insert my new cloaked .PHP file into it? would i use the HTML option or how can i do it?
